#FE5289 Color
#FE5289 is rgb(254, 82, 137) in RGB, hsl(341, 99%, 66%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 68%, 46%, 0%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Strawberry (#FC5A8D),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.57.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#FE5289 Channel Values
How #FE5289 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 254 · G 82 · B 137 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 341° · S 99% · L 66%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 341° · S 68% · V 100%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 68% · Y 46% · K 0%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.1:1 vs white · 6.78: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#FE5289 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#FE5289 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#FE5289?
#FE5289 is a light pink — rgb(254, 82, 137) in RGB and hsl(341, 99%, 66%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Strawberry (#FC5A8D),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.57.
What is the RGB value of #FE5289?
#FE5289 is rgb(254, 82, 137) — red 254, green 82, and blue 137 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#FE5289?
#FE5289 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 68%, 46%, 0%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#FE5289 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#FE5289 scores 3.1:1 against white and 6.78: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#FE5289 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#FE5289 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is hotpink (#FF69B4) at a CIE76 distance of 19.42, which is visibly different.
